kuldeepkrlhd
Don’t go for Top One Percent Auttri’s service.. I saw many ads and reviews in his website and paid 75k for 3 business schools. I didn’t get help that I needed.. not even one mock interview
I would say otherwise. Be it Autrri, Lewllyn, or any other consultant, they will not call you to have your essays sorted or interviews sorted you have to go to them, you need to understand that they are working with 100s like you, its you who need to buy their time.

Iff you are working with some agency which works as an organisation than you may expect to reach out to you but at the same time they charge upwards of 2 lakhs. If you want consultants those handle your profile individually you have to put efforts to buy their time, they simply don’t have time to track.

Not commenting on this particular case or the consultants in question but on your largelt point

It depends on the level of ownership. If one doesn’t have the time, then one shouldn’t take on more candidates. Simple.

I wouldn’t put the Consultants on that high a pedestal!
Yes, in general the candidate should be more proactive since it’s their application at the end of the day and their career at stake. However, the complete onus shouldn’t be on the candidate either.

Good consultants would follow up a few times if a candidate isn’t pulling their weight and then eventually let it go after a point.
